X. J. Wu is a scholar working on Ecology, Molecular Biology and Astronomy and Astrophysics. According to data from OpenAlex, X. J. Wu has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 669 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Ecology, 2 papers in Molecular Biology and 2 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ics. Recurrent topics in X. J. Wu's work include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(2 papers), Microbial Community Ecology and Physiology (2 papers) and Pulsars and Gravitational Waves Research (2 papers). X. J. Wu is often cited by papers focused on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(2 papers), Microbial Community Ecology and Physiology (2 papers) and Pulsars and Gravitational Waves Research (2 papers). X. J. Wu collaborates with scholars based in China. X. J. Wu's co-authors include Meng Li, Mark Bartlam, Yingying Wang, Yao Li, Jie Pan, Yingying Wang, Zongbao Liu, Renxin Xu, Na Wang and Xiangqing Ma and has published in prestigious journals such as Water Research, Journal of Hazardous Materials and Plants.
